#6b418b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b418b is composed of 42% red, 25.5%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 274.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 40%. #6b418b color hex could be obtained by blending #d682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#6b418b color description : Dark moderate violet.
#6b418b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b418b has RGB values of R:107, G:65,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 7029131.

Shades and Tints of #6b418b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040205 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b418b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67606c is the less saturated color, while #7302ca is the most saturated one.
